Exactly How to Fix Usual LG Dish Washer Issues: A Step-by-Step Guide
LG dish washers are understood for their dependability, but like any device, they can develop problems with time. Whether your LG dishwashing machine won't start, isn't draining, or is displaying error codes, there's usually a simple fix. In this overview, we'll stroll you with typical LG dishwashing machine fixing steps to get your appliance running efficiently once more.

1. LG Dish Washer Will Not Begin
If your LG dishwashing machine won't start, adhere to these actions:

Inspect the power connection. Guarantee the dishwasher is connected in and the breaker isn't stumbled.
Ensure the door is properly latched. If the LG dishwasher door will not shut, check the latch for damages or particles.
Reset your dishwashing machine. Turn off the power for a couple of mins and after that turn it back on. A LG dish washer reset can commonly fix minor concerns.
2. LG Dishwasher Not Draining Pipes
One of one of the most typical troubles is a dish washer not draining effectively. Right here's just how to fix it:

Tidy the filter: A clogged filter can protect against water from draining pipes. Get rid of and rinse it under running water.
Check the drainpipe hose pipe: Make certain the pipe is not kinked or blocked.
Evaluate the pump: If your LG dishwashing machine pump repair is required, check for food bits or debris embeded the pump.
3. LG Dishwasher Mistake Codes
If your LG dishwashing machine mistake codes are flashing, below's what they imply:

OE Mistake-- This indicates a drain problem. Adhere to the steps over to check the filter, tube, and pump.
LE Error-- This suggests there's a motor concern, potentially as a result of an overloaded dishwasher or a malfunctioning motor.
HE Mistake-- This relates to heating up concerns. Guarantee the burner is working appropriately.
4. LG Dish Washer Beeping and Flashing Lights
If your LG dish washer warning continuously or presenting LG dishwasher flashing lights, adhere to these steps:

Check for a mistake code. A continual beep frequently signifies a problem.
Ensure the dishwashing machine isn't strained. Way too many dishes can trigger efficiency issues.
Reset the dishwashing machine by disconnecting it for a couple of minutes.
5. LG Dish Washer Water Leak
A LG dishwasher water leak can be discouraging. Below's exactly how to repair it:

Evaluate the door seal: If it's worn or cracked, replace it.
Check the spray arms: Misaligned or blocked spray arms can trigger leaks.
Try to find a malfunctioning inlet valve: A leaking inlet valve may require to be changed.
6. LG Dish Washer Won't Dry Cuisines
If your LG dishwasher won't dry out recipes, right here's what to do:

Use wash aid: This assists water evaporate quicker.
Examine the burner: A defective component won't dry meals properly.
Open the door after the cycle: Allowing vapor retreat speeds up drying out.
7. LG Dishwashing Machine Won't Full Of Water
When your LG dishwashing machine won't full of water, try these actions:

Make sure the water system is turned on.
Examine the water inlet valve for blockages.
Look for a stopped up filter or spray arm.
